Monthly Cost of Living

A single person spends $1,261 per month in Phuket vs $879 in Belgorod, rent included.

A couple spends around $2,286 per month in Phuket vs $1,344 in Belgorod, rent included.

A family of three spends $3,310 per month in Phuket vs $1,808 in Belgorod, rent included.

Phuket costs about 43% more than Belgorod,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.

Both Phuket and Belgorod are more affordable than the global median – Phuket 6% lower, Belgorod 35% lower.

Cost Breakdown

A central one-bedroom costs $619 in Phuket versus $562 in Belgorod.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.

Salaries run about 3% higher in Belgorod, which reinforces the cost advantage – you earn more and spend less. Purchasing power leans clearly in its favor.

A mid-range dinner for two costs $47.00 in Phuket versus $37.00 in Belgorod.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$293 vs $171 – making Belgorod the more affordable choice for daily food spending.
